Software Engineer
Role details
Job location
Tech stack
Job description
- Be paired with an onboarding buddy who will introduce you to the world of equity management
- Get to know our engineering team, product managers, and designers
- Understand how your team's surface area connects to the broader Ledgy platform
- Start contributing to the codebase with guidance from experienced team members
In the first 3 months
-
Ship independently on impactful product features and improvements
-
Participate in architecture discussions around scaling workflows, data models, and integrations
-
Work alongside other engineers to implement robust, reliable data flows
-
Develop a deep understanding of how companies manage and automate equity
-
Participate in code reviews and help maintain our engineering standards In the first 6-12 months
-
Take ownership of key features and improvements within your team's domain
-
Help shape the technical direction and architecture of Ledgy's equity platform
-
Collaborate with Product and Design to deliver polished, user-centric experiences
-
Mentor other engineers and share expertise in automation, data modeling, and scalability Teams and focus areas
-
Core Equity - Owns the foundational logic that powers Ledgy's equity engine. This team defines and maintains the transaction logic, data model, and core domain behaviour to ensure accuracy, scalability, and compliance.
-
Workflows & Automation - Automates complex equity workflows and integrations with third-party services, enabling onboarding / offboarding, equity grants, terminations, and post-vest liquidity.
-
Reporting - Transforms Ledgy's core equity data into financial, operational, and compliance reports, managing large datasets across jurisdictions and company structures to support decision-making and transparency. The job is a good fit if, * Language : TypeScript
-
Frontend : React, Tailwind CSS, tRPC
-
Backend : tRPC, Node.js, MongoDB
-
Infrastructure : GCP, Terraform Cloud, Kubernetes, Docker, Github Actions The interview process
-
CV Review : We review your resume to see if we might be a good fit
-
Getting to know you (30 min) : Meet with someone from our people team to discuss your experience and the role
-
Live Coding (75 min) : Solve an equity domain problem collaboratively in your preferred language
-
System Design (60 min) : Walk us through an architecture you contributed to, exploring relevant aspects
-
Culture Interview : Meet with a founder for a 30-minute chat about Ledgy's mission and values
-
Offer Seniority level
Requirements
- You have 7+ years of experience as a Software Engineer
- You're excited about the impact of equity on entrepreneurship and its real-world impact for companies
- You enjoy tackling complex financial data transformations and compliance requirements
- You enjoy writing clean, maintainable TypeScript code, both backend and frontend
- You are excited to work with React, NodeJS, and MongoDB
- You thrive in collaborative environments and enjoy pair programming
- You take pride in creating robust, tested solutions for critical business operations
Benefits & conditions
- Flexible working hours, 25 days of vacation, and up to 40 days of remote work from outside your home country
- Professional development support with a generous yearly learning & development budget
- Competitive salary + benefits + equity, with ranges aligned to location and leveling
- For candidates based in London or Zurich, a hybrid model of 1 day in the office per week